CVE-2023-27992 — Zyxel Multiple NAS Devices Command Injection Vulnerability

Severity: Critical · Kind: Vulnerability

Zyxel Multiple Network-Attached Storage (NAS) Devices. Multiple Zyxel network-attached storage (NAS) devices contain a pre-authentication command injection vulnerability that could allow an unauthenticated attacker to execute commands remotely via a crafted HTTP request. Required action: Apply updates per vendor instructions.
